2010-10-13 49 views
0

基本上我有兩件事情我從一個命令參數傳遞asp.net/sql得到字符串在之前的所有「 - 」,並把它變成一個不同的字符串

<asp:LinkButton ID="lbEditDetails" Text="Edit..." runat="server" CommandName="EditDetails" CssClass="EditAdults" CommandArgument=<%# DataBinder.Eval(Container.DataItem, "number_slept") & "-" & DataBinder.Eval(Container.DataItem, "booking_ref") %>></asp:LinkButton> 

我要搶number_slept這是-之前的一切,並把它變成另一個字符串,然後搶booking_ref這是-後,並將它放入一個字符串

下面是我得到了什麼

Dim strPassedString = e.CommandArgument 

Dim NumberSlept = This will be the passed number slept 

Dim BookingRef = This will be the passed booking ref 

我不知道如何拆分命令參數

可能嗎?

感謝

傑米

回答

2

String.Split

C#,但你的想法...

string numberSlept = e.CommandArgument.Split('-')[0]; 
string bookingRef = e.CommandArgument.Split('-')[1]; 
相關問題